Transaction 62bcd3d21c0d95272b265190a31f1babd50e3f1fd75d683ffb3834fd49e7ecd9

2 Input
2 Outputs
  • 62bcd3d21c0d95272b265190a31f1babd50e3f1fd75d683ffb3834fd49e7ecd9:0
  • value  59023754
    address  38U26wvZi6GvUYLN5CTqvjpFFVQBGzdpCj
  • 62bcd3d21c0d95272b265190a31f1babd50e3f1fd75d683ffb3834fd49e7ecd9:1
  • value  902146
    address  1Pe1yNFgj5rPi1nn8RUbBZDTizspjdpVRw